Browse Source

项目状态保持与字典一致

master
qqkj 5 years ago
parent
commit
3f531f9cff
  1. 8
      xm-core/src/main/java/com/xm/core/service/XmProjectService.java

8
xm-core/src/main/java/com/xm/core/service/XmProjectService.java

@ -266,7 +266,7 @@ public class XmProjectService extends BaseService {
}else if("xm_project_start_approva".equals(bizKey)) {//立项 立项通过需要把预算数据同步到财务系统把项目数据同步到财务系统 }else if("xm_project_start_approva".equals(bizKey)) {//立项 立项通过需要把预算数据同步到财务系统把项目数据同步到财务系统
XmProject project=new XmProject(); XmProject project=new XmProject();
project.setId(bizProject.getId()); project.setId(bizProject.getId());
project.setStatus("2");
project.setStatus("ssz");
//todo 立项通过需要把预算数据同步到财务系统把项目数据同步到财务系统 //todo 立项通过需要把预算数据同步到财务系统把项目数据同步到财务系统
this.updateSomeFieldByPk(project); this.updateSomeFieldByPk(project);
@ -282,7 +282,7 @@ public class XmProjectService extends BaseService {
}else if("xm_project_over_approva".equals(bizKey) ) { //结项 }else if("xm_project_over_approva".equals(bizKey) ) { //结项
XmProject project=new XmProject(); XmProject project=new XmProject();
project.setId(bizProject.getId()); project.setId(bizProject.getId());
project.setStatus("3");
project.setStatus("yjx");
this.updateSomeFieldByPk(project); this.updateSomeFieldByPk(project);
this.createBaseline(bizProject.getId(),"项目结项申请通过审批"); this.createBaseline(bizProject.getId(),"项目结项申请通过审批");
xmRecordService.addXmProjectRecord(bizProject.getId(), "项目-结项", "项目结项申请通过审批" ); xmRecordService.addXmProjectRecord(bizProject.getId(), "项目-结项", "项目结项申请通过审批" );
@ -295,13 +295,13 @@ public class XmProjectService extends BaseService {
}else if("xm_project_restart_approva".equals(bizKey) ) { //重新启动 }else if("xm_project_restart_approva".equals(bizKey) ) { //重新启动
XmProject project=new XmProject(); XmProject project=new XmProject();
project.setId(bizProject.getId()); project.setId(bizProject.getId());
project.setStatus("2");
project.setStatus("ssz");
this.updateSomeFieldByPk(project); this.updateSomeFieldByPk(project);
xmRecordService.addXmProjectRecord(bizProject.getId(), "项目-重新启动", "项目重新启动申请通过审批" ); xmRecordService.addXmProjectRecord(bizProject.getId(), "项目-重新启动", "项目重新启动申请通过审批" );
}else if("xm_project_pause_approva".equals(bizKey) ) { //暂停 }else if("xm_project_pause_approva".equals(bizKey) ) { //暂停
XmProject project=new XmProject(); XmProject project=new XmProject();
project.setId(bizProject.getId()); project.setId(bizProject.getId());
project.setStatus("4");
project.setStatus("ztz");
this.updateSomeFieldByPk(project); this.updateSomeFieldByPk(project);
xmRecordService.addXmProjectRecord(bizProject.getId(), "项目-暂停", "项目暂停申请通过审批" ); xmRecordService.addXmProjectRecord(bizProject.getId(), "项目-暂停", "项目暂停申请通过审批" );
} }

Loading…
Cancel
Save